Who all is a part of YMCMB?

Current artists include Lil Wayne, Nicki Minaj, Mack Maine, Lil Twist, and Cory Gunz, among others. The label has released three compilation albums — We Are Young Money (2009), Rich Gang (2013; with Cash Money Records), and Young Money: Rise of an Empire (2014).

Who owns Drake’s Masters?

Last week, we learned Lil Wayne sold his masters to Universal Music Group for $100 million. A new report unveils that Drake, Nicki Minaj and Tyga’s catalogs under Young Money were sold along with Lil Wayne’s catalog.

What does YMCMB stand for?

Young Money Cash Money Billionaires
YMCMB is an acronym that stands for Young Money Cash Money Billionaires. It is used to refer to the artists represented by Young Money Entertainment and Cash Money Records, such as Lil Wayne and Drake, and their respective lifestyles.
